WebDec 19, 2014 · Beet pulp with added molasses will contain high levels of sugar and potassium and therefore is a poor choice for horses suffering from HYPP or insulin resistance. However, keep in mind that beet pulp without molasses added does not cause these problems. Beet pulp nutritional value at a glance. WebSep 19, 2024 · Equine nutritionist, Kelly Vineyard discusses beet pulp in this article. She states that beet pulp is a highly digestible form of fiber which is greater than or equal to most hays. She then goes on to explain that beet pulp’s energy value is higher than alfalfa and is therefore a great source of fiber and calories to aid in better body condition. WebTo the contrary, beet pulp is very low in starch and sugar, usually containing only 2-10% total carbohydrates. WebSacked beet pulp pellet truckloads contain about 22 tons. Beet pulp pellets can be ground and delivered in bulk or 50 pound bags. TYPICAL ANALYSIS: Crude Protein 7.0% Crude Fat 0.5-0.6% Crude Fiber 15.0-20.0% Ash 4.0-5.0% Moisture 8.0-12.0% TDN 74.0% NEL 0.81 Mcal/lbs. Calcium 0.6% Phosphorus 0.1%

WebMar 6, 2024 · 4. May Lower Blood Pressure. In a study conducted at the Queen Mary University of London, beetroot juice was found to lower blood pressure in a matter of four weeks. As per experts, this is because of the presence of nitrates, which the body converts into nitric oxide. In the process, the blood vessels expand ( 9 ).
